About the role

We\’re looking for someone special to join our double award-winning User Research & Experimentation team at John Lewis. At John Lewis, we generate valuable insights through large-scale experiments and user research. We aim to leverage these insights to enhance business decisions.

In this role, you\’ll work with insights from our User Researchers and the outputs of experiments, integrating these with other sources like Behavioral Analytics and Desk research to inform decisions within our Digital and Ecommerce team.

You should have hands-on experience with both experimentation and user research outputs, confident in analyzing data in spreadsheets and interpreting qualitative insights from user sessions. Strong communication skills are essential to convey findings effectively and support better decision-making.

Target salary: up to 60k

Working pattern/flexible working: The Partnership adopts a hybrid approach, allowing a mix of office and home working, typically 1-2 days in the office weekly.

Location: London Head Office, Pimlico

Job Title: User Research & Experimentation Strategist (internal title)

Essential skills/experience:

  • Strong understanding of data analysis, including statistics, with proficiency in spreadsheets.
  • Experience with large-scale A/B testing and its application in decision-making.
  • Knowledge of user research methods to improve digital products and services.
  • Ability to collaborate with stakeholders, gather requirements, and present findings persuasively.
  • Excellent communication skills for technical and non-technical audiences.

Desirable skills/experience:

  • Experience working in agile environments on digital projects.
  • Proficiency with data visualization tools.
  • Experience with large datasets related to digital customer behavior and e-commerce.
  • Understanding of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) principles.
  • Experience with web analytics tools like Adobe, GA, ContentSquare.
